Sandra Foreman's Obituary
Sandra Foreman, a spirited and passionate soul, departed from this world on April 11, 2024, in Alexander City, Alabama, at the age of 81. Born on February 18, 1943, in Tampa, Florida, Sandra lived a life marked by her love for family, nature, and the simple joys of cooking and caring for her fruit trees and beloved dogs.
Sandra's legacy is carried on by her devoted children: James (Bonita) Foreman, Sandra (Antonio) Mancilla, Jackie Foreman, and Dwight (Kimberly) Foreman. Her love and teachings are further reflected in the lives of her cherished grandchildren: Roland (Melissa) Mancilla, Christopher (Regina) Foreman, Diana Lynn (Norman Sayers) Foreman, Amber (Terrell Adair) Foreman, Christina (Cody Lanthrip) Foreman, David (Destiny) Robison, Kandis (Adam) Honeycutt, Cameron Foreman, Noah Mackenzie, Albert (Angel) Mancilla, Tony (Wendy) Mancilla, Heather Foreman, and Dustin Foreman. Sandra's vibrant spirit will also live on through the many great-grandchildren who brought her immeasurable joy.
Her siblings, Katie Christian, June Hall, Eugene Hall, Pam Hall, Nelda Hall, and Brenda Hall, will hold Sandra's memory dear, as she was a cornerstone in their family. Sandra was welcomed into eternity by her late father, Russell Hall, her mother, Luthia Hall, her nephew, Charles Harrelson, her loving husband, James G. Foreman, Sr., and a host of other brothers and sisters who had passed before her.
Sandra's life was characterized by hard work and dedication, as evidenced by her years spent as a field worker in strawberry fields and vegetable fields. Her work ethic was unparalleled, and she instilled this value in her family. Despite the demands of her job, Sandra always found time to indulge in her interests. She was an exceptional cook, known for her signature touch of black pepper on every dish. Her fruit trees were tended with care, and the sight of hummingbirds fluttering in her garden brought her endless delight.
